Salary
💰 $98,124 - $166,810 per year
Tech Stack
ApacheAWSCloudJavaJenkinsPostgresPythonSpark
About the role
- Migrate data from SAS to Python
- Design and build software processing pipelines using tools and frameworks in the AWS ecosystem
- Analyze requirements and architecture specifications to create a detailed design document
- Responsible for full cycle software engineering functions
- Work with large scale data sets
- Work with DevOps engineers on CI, CD, and IaC (Continuous Integration, Continuous Delivery, and Infrastructure as Code) processes; read specifications and translate them into code and design documents; and perform code reviews and develop processes for improving code quality
- Be proactive and constantly pay attention to the scalability, performance, and availability of our systems
- Responsible for deploying the developed solution in AWS environment and examine the results for accuracy
- Perform code reviews and develop processes for improving code quality
Requirements
- Bachelor's degree required (degree in Computer Science or related field preferred)
- 5+ years of high-volume software engineering experience
- 2+ years of experience working in Python
- 2+ years of experience migrating code to a cloud environment
- 2+ years of experience with Agile methodology
- Candidate must be able to obtain and maintain a Public Trust Clearance
- Candidate must reside in the U.S., be authorized to work in the U.S., and all work must be performed in the U.S.
- Candidate must have lived in the U.S. for three (3) full years out of the last five (5) years